MEMO — Sales Leads, Ferrowind Analytics

Effective immediately: discounts above 15% on Cloudspar Enterprise require written approval from Regional Director Halvorsen. No exceptions for deals under 200 seats. Deals over 500 seats may go to 22% with deal-desk review. Stop pre-committing numbers in verbal negotiations; we've eaten margin three quarters running. Multi-year terms earn an extra 3% maximum. Log everything in the Quotelane tracker by Friday. Questions go to deal desk, not to me. Read the following carefully before quoting anything.

board note of bawep-tajef: Queniusek Systems plans to raise the Quenvan list price by 53.1 percent in March. The pricing group signed off on a budget of $176.4 million for Project Drueth. The renewal with Casionix Partners closes at $142.5 million a year, 8.3 percent below the last contract. Project Fraax slips by six weeks because of the tooling delay.

# Transporting Stage Props — Moonwake Players Tour

Quick guide for shift leads moving props for the Moonwake Players. Most pieces travel in numbered road cases; the oversized moon backdrop rides flat in the long crate, never on its edge. Count cases against the tour manifest before and after loading — the props master will absolutely notice a missing lantern. Wrap anything loose, tag anything fragile, and keep the foam swords away from the heaters. When the courier shows up, follow the hand-over instruction below.

dispatch memo: the eliiel eliys courier leaves the gorox zorox framir olieth ulaius kasion wenox aldvan ledger at gate 1359 under passcode 734733

Subject: Handover — Pingwick deploy bot

For the sync: handing Pingwick (the deploy-status chat bot) to the next release manager. It polls the pipeline every 30s, posts to the release channel, and pages on failed promotions. Known issue: duplicate messages after runner restarts — dedupe fix is in review. Config lives in the ops repo; redeploy via the standard chart. The bot authenticates to the pipeline host over SSH. Rotate on handover as usual; current deploy key is below.

signing key of bagap-yawep = bky13_TbfT6ZMUoGJo2